About Tim Braheem

Founder, CEO & Head Coach of Performance Experts

Tim Braheem’s extensive experience in the mortgage industry spans over two and a half decades, during which he has made significant contributions to both loan origination and professional development with his impressive origination business and as a co-founder of Loan Toolbox. Tim’s approach to coaching and education is deeply influenced by his Master of Arts Degree in Spiritual Psychology and the founding and development of the Leadership 360 Coaching Program, widely recognized as the premier coaching program in the industry. Tim’s wealth of experience, comprehensive coaching approach, and unwavering commitment to excellence make him uniquely qualified to empower mortgage professionals to foster personal growth and professional excellence for members of The Loan Atlas.

About The Panelists

Rose Marie David

Senior Vice President of Retail Sales – CMG Home Loans

With 30+ years in mortgage banking, Rose Marie David has led some of the industry’s most successful growth initiatives. As SVP of Retail Sales at CMG Home Loans, she oversees expansion following CMG’s acquisition of Homebridge Financial’s retail division. Previously, she helped scale HomeStreet Bank’s mortgage business by 400%, earning Top 20 Retail Mortgage Lender rankings and #1 purchase market share in the Pacific Northwest. A 2018 HW Vanguard Award winner, she has served on industry advisory boards for FNMA, Freddie Mac, Ellie Mae, ICE, and Xinnix, shaping the future of mortgage lending.

OB Jacobi

President/Owner – Windermere Real Estate

OB Jacobi is the president of Windermere Real Estate, leading one of the largest and most respected regional real estate brands in the U.S. With a focus on technology and innovation, he has helped drive Windermere’s growth to over 7,000 agents across 300 offices. OB also oversees 11 family-owned offices in Seattle, where his team-based management system has secured a 40%+ market share. A forward-thinking leader, he is dedicated to pushing the real estate industry toward greater efficiency and excellence.

Jennifer LInd

Regional President, West Region – Coldwell Banker Realty

Jennifer Lind leads Coldwell Banker Realty’s operations across California, Washington, Oregon, and Hawaii, overseeing 130+ offices and 11,000 agents. Previously, as President of Coldwell Banker Northern California, she drove over $22.6 billion in sales. With leadership roles at Windermere Real Estate and John L. Scott, she has shaped strategy, growth, and marketing for top real estate brands. A former agent, franchise owner, and industry board member, Jennifer is a recognized leader driving excellence in real estate.

Casey Oiness

Branch Manager – Guild Mortgage

Casey Oiness leads Guild Mortgage’s Bellevue branch, consistently ranking among the top-producing teams nationwide. Leveraging his financial advising background, he has built a high-performance team known for exceptional service, rapid turn-times, and delivering results. Under his leadership, the team has become a standout in volume, product availability, and customer satisfaction in the mortgage industry.

Max Rombakh

Managing Broker – Windermere Real Estate/East Inc.

A top-producing broker with over $1 billion in sales, Max Rombakh specializes in luxury and distinctive residential properties on the Greater Eastside. Named the #1 Broker in Kirkland multiple times, he is known for his strategic marketing, expert negotiation, and client-first approach. With over 20 years in real estate, Max has earned recognition for his industry expertise, including features on KOMO 4 News and HGTV.

Moya Skillman

Principal Broker – Team Foster, COMPASS

Moya Skillman is the co-founder of Team Foster, a top-producing real estate team selling over $200M annually. With 20+ years in residential real estate, she leads the team’s marketing across print, digital, and social media, shaping the strategy behind one of the Northwest’s most recognized luxury brands. In 2016, she co-founded Avenue Properties, which became one of the region’s largest real estate firms before its acquisition by COMPASS. Featured in The Wall Street Journal, The New York Times, and HGTV, Moya is a driving force in luxury real estate marketing.

About Legacy Group Capital

Legacy Group Capital (Legacy) is an integrated real estate company focused on community-based engagement in private lending and real estate investing. Legacy empowers homebuilders, real estate investors, homeowners, and homebuyers with a flexible lending and investment platform. The Legacy platform offers unique and creative financial products that extend beyond standard guidelines. These products encompass acquisition loans, construction loans, rehab financing, and bridge loans that all reflect our common-sense approach to lending.

Currently, Legacy works with hundreds of homebuilders, brokers and mortgage loan officers while also serving thousands of investors across five real estate investment funds with access to over $500 million in equity and debt capital.
